Overview

Henderson North School is a state contributing school in Henderson, Auckland. It is a co-educational school. The school has 357 students on the roll. Its Equity Index (EQI) is 477 (above-average equity need). The school has an enrolment scheme (zone). It is located in the Henderson-Massey Local Board Area territorial authority.

Equity Index (EQI)

The Equity Index replaced the decile system in 2023. It measures the socio-economic context of a school's student community. A higher EQI indicates greater equity need (more disadvantaged). The national average is approximately 463.
